How often should I water bougainvillea?

Bougainvillea should not be watered unless the soil is dry. Each time you water it, you should wait until the soil is completely dry. In spring and autumn, you can water it once a day. In summer, you should water it in the morning and evening. During the winter, you should water it less because its growth rate will slow down. As long as the soil is not too dry, you can use well water or tap water for watering.

Bougainvillea watering method

1. Pay attention to the dryness and wetness of the soil : When watering bougainvillea, you must pay attention to the dryness and wetness of the potting soil, especially in the summer when the light is relatively strong. If you choose to water at noon, the roots of the plant will be burned, so it is best for us to do it in the morning and evening.

2. Watering for different varieties : From June to July, control the water 3-4 times according to different varieties. The degree of water control should make the branches and leaves wilt slightly. At this time, spray water on the leaves 1-2 times a day, and water them thoroughly after 2-3 days.

3. Water control : Water control of Bougainvillea lasts for about three weeks. Water control is carried out before flowering, and water control must be completed. When controlling water, water half less than usual, or only spray.

Tips for watering bougainvillea

1. No water accumulation on rainy days : When it rains, you can stop watering, but be careful not to allow water accumulation when watering.

2. Watering in summer : When watering in summer, be sure not to choose to do it in the sun, and also avoid watering at noon.

What to do if you water bougainvillea too much

1. Prune the roots if you water too much. If it does not affect the roots, you should take the bougainvillea out of the soil in time, prune the rotten parts of the roots, and apply wood ash on the pruning wounds before planting.

2. Replace the soil. You can also replace the soil by using a mixture of leaf mold, garden soil and sand in a suitable ratio of 4:3:2 to replant the plants. This can effectively prevent the appearance of viruses in the soil with too much water, which can affect the growth of bougainvillea or even kill it.
